What this Trial Is About
This trial will study the safety and efficacy of intravenous infusion of cultured allogeneic adult umbilical cord derived mesenchymal stem cells for the treatment of Autism

Who Can Participate
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if you...
- Diagnosis of Autism
You will not qualify if you...
- Active infection
- Active cancer
- Chronic multisystem organ failure
- Pregnancy
- Clinically significant abnormalities on pre-treatment laboratory evaluation
- Medical condition that could compromise patient's safety based on investigator's opinion
- Previous organ transplant
- Seizure disorder
- Hypersensitivity to sulfur
